New Palfinger Platforms Italy sales manager

31 October 2018

photo

Paolo Balugani, (left) and Alfredo Careddu.

Palfinger Platforms Italy (PPI) has appointed Alfredo Careddu as its new sales manager for Italy.

Careddu, who begins the role November, has vast experience in the aerial platforms sector and will work alongside Catia Polli, a longstanding member of the PPI team. In its five years the Emilian region-based manufacturer, subsidiary of Palfinger, has built a strong presence sector. 

”I am very proud to take on this new role in Palfinger Platforms Italy, a young, dynamic company,” said Careddu.

Paolo Balugani, director of Palfinger Platforms Italy, added, ”Alfredo will bring to the company his extensive sales experience gained over many years of business in the sector and this will be for us an additional driving force to approach the market with new ideas and initiatives to keep up with the constant demands of our customers.

”On behalf of all the people of Palfinger Platforms Italy, we give Alfredo a warm welcome to our team.”
